Marsh Supermarkets to Auction Surplus Property

INDIANAPOLIS -- Marsh Supermarkets here will offer 27 surplus properties at auction both in Indianapolis and worldwide via real-time Internet broadcast this Thursday, including some of what the company said are prime properties that no longer fit into its corporate strategy.

Marsh offer the properties simultaneously at auction in the Holiday Inn Select Grand Ballroom located adjacent to the Indianapolis Airport at 2501 S. High School Road Indianapolis, Indiana, and via real-time online bidding at www.naalive.com

Marsh will use the proceeds of the auction to continue its efforts in renovating and upgrading its operating stores.

“Although these properties no longer fit into the future plans of Marsh, they are located in many prime markets around the region with some of the locations being no more than a few years old and fully equipped,” said John Haney, general manager of Higgenbotham Auctioneers International Ltd.(HAI), which is handling the auction for the retailer.

“By offering the sale of these properties via the Internet, we expand the base of interested buyers, thus giving those who cannot travel to the actual sale site the opportunity to participate in a convenient and secure manner,” said Haney, noting that the NAALive.com application allows bidders to participate in real time as if they were attending the auction in person.

The inventory consists of 15 retail outparcels/development tracts and 12 retail buildings. No open locations are included in the auction, Marsh said.
